1. What is the primary purpose of the National Electrical Code (NEC) in an
electrical installation?

A. To establish electrical utility rates
B. To provide practical safeguards for persons and property from hazards arising
from electricity
C. To regulate electrical contractor business taxes
D. To establish wholesale equipment prices

Answer: To provide practical safeguards for persons and property from hazards
arising from electricity

Rationale: The NEC establishes minimum safety requirements for electrical
installations. It is intended primarily to protect people and property from
electrical hazards rather than regulate business operations or utility pricing.

, 2. In a dwelling unit, what is the general maximum rating of a single
receptacle installed on an individual branch circuit rated 20 amperes?

A. 15 amperes
B. 20 amperes
C. 25 amperes
D. 30 amperes

Answer: 20 amperes

Rationale: A single receptacle on an individual branch circuit must generally
have a rating not less than the branch-circuit rating. A 20-ampere individual
circuit therefore requires a receptacle rated at least 20 amperes.

3. Which conductor is normally identified by a continuous white or gray
finish?

A. Ungrounded conductor
B. Equipment grounding conductor
C. Grounded conductor
D. Switched conductor

Answer: Grounded conductor

Rationale: The grounded conductor is generally identified by white or gray
insulation or markings. The identification rules help prevent confusion between
grounded, ungrounded, and grounding conductors.

4. What is the principal function of an equipment grounding conductor?

A. To carry normal circuit current
B. To increase circuit voltage
C. To provide a low-impedance path for fault current
D. To reduce the connected load

Answer: To provide a low-impedance path for fault current

,Rationale: The equipment grounding conductor provides an effective fault-
current path that permits overcurrent protective devices to operate promptly
when a fault occurs.

5. A 120/240-volt single-phase dwelling service has a calculated load of 150
amperes. What is the minimum service rating based solely on that
calculated load?

A. 100 amperes
B. 125 amperes
C. 150 amperes
D. 200 amperes

Answer: 150 amperes

Rationale: The service rating cannot be less than the calculated load. Other
requirements may cause a larger service to be selected, but the calculated load
establishes a minimum of 150 amperes in this example.

6. Which device is designed primarily to protect people from electric shock
caused by current flowing through an unintended path to ground?

A. AFCI
B. GFCI
C. Surge protective device
D. Disconnect switch

Answer: GFCI

Rationale: A ground-fault circuit-interrupter detects an imbalance between
current leaving and returning on the circuit conductors and opens the circuit
when the leakage reaches its trip threshold.

7. What is the purpose of an arc-fault circuit interrupter?

A. To regulate voltage
B. To protect against hazardous arcing conditions

, C. To increase available fault current
D. To replace all overcurrent protection

Answer: To protect against hazardous arcing conditions

Rationale: AFCIs are intended to detect dangerous arcing conditions and
interrupt the circuit before the arc can develop into a fire hazard.

8. A conductor supplying a continuous load must generally be sized so that
the ampacity is at least what percentage of the continuous load?

A. 80%
B. 100%
C. 110%
D. 125%

Answer: 125%

Rationale: Continuous loads are generally calculated at 125 percent for
conductor and overcurrent-protection sizing unless a specific provision permits
otherwise.

9. A circuit supplies a continuous load of 32 amperes. What minimum
ampacity is generally required for the conductors?

A. 32 amperes
B. 35 amperes
C. 40 amperes
D. 45 amperes

Answer: 40 amperes

Rationale: Thirty-two amperes multiplied by 125 percent equals 40 amperes.
The conductor ampacity must therefore generally be at least 40 amperes before
applicable adjustment and correction considerations.
